Complete the following sequence.
Question 1.
9 × 6 = 54
9 × 66 = 594
9 × 666 = 5994
9 × 6666 = 5 ____ 4
9 × 666666 = ______
Answer:
9 × 6666 = 59994
9 × 666666 =5999994

Question 2.
9 × 111 = 999
9 × 222 = 1998
9 × 333 = 2997
9 × 444 = ______
9 × 555 = ______
9 × 666 = ______
Answer:
9 × 444 = 3996
9 × 555 = 4995
9 × 666 = 5994.
